django-compass2.

Einfache Zusammenstellung von Kompassprojekten für Django
Jetzt downloaden

django-compass2. Ranking & Zusammenfassung

Anzeige

  • Rating:
  • Lizenz:
  • Public Domain
  • Preis:
  • FREE
  • Name des Herausgebers:
  • Slawomir Ehlert
  • Website des Verlags:
  • http://bitbucket.org/slafs/

django-compass2. Stichworte


django-compass2. Beschreibung

DJANGO-COMPASS2 ist eine wiederverwendbare Django-App, die eine einfache Möglichkeit bietet, Ihre Kompass- oder Sass-basierten Stylesheets an CSS zusammenzustellen. Der Hauptnutzen ist die Integration von Django-Einstellungen, sodass Sie nicht viele kompass.rb-Konfigurationsdateien benötigen (insbesondere mit mehreren Bereitstellungen, etcetera). Abgesehen davon ist es einfach ein Proxy an den Compass Command-Line Application.Installation und Setup - Sie müssen den Kompass installieren. Dies ist eine Rubin-Bibliothek, also verwenden Sie das GEM-Dienstprogramm (installiert (installiertes Out-of-the-Box in den meisten Systemen): Edelstein installieren Compass --PRE - dann verwenden Sie einfach PIP oder EASY_INSTALL, um Django-Compass2 (die Abhängigkeiten) zu installieren Wird automatisch gehandhabt Schauen Sie sich die untenstehende Konfigurationsreferenz für weitere Informationen an, aber hier ist ein kurzes Beispiel: compass_input = project_root + 'media / sass' compass_output = project_root + 'media / css' compass_style = 'Compact' Compass_Requires = ('Ninesxty', # 960 python manage.py compassUsageThe Kommandozeilen-Schnittstelle ist sehr einfach: - .gs Grid System) Sie können nun Ihre Sass mit dem Management Befehl kompilieren. Um verfügbare Optionen und Befehle zu sehen, versuchen Sie es: Python Manage.py Compass --helpbasally Die Syntax ist so einfach wie: Python Manage.py Compass Erstellen Sie einfach Ihr Sass in CSS: Python Manage.py Compass gibt Medien / CssunchaGed Media / Sass /style.sassthe oben den Befehl ist mehr oder weniger gleichwertig der Aufrufung: Kompass --sass-dir Media / SASS - CCSS-DIR Media / CSS -Output-Stil CompactMonitor Ihr Sass ständig: Python Manage.py Compass Watch >>> Kompass schaut sich nach Änderungen an. Drücken Sie STRG-C, um zu stoppen. >>> Änderung erkannt an: ... / media / sass / style.sassoverwrite medien / css / style.css ... was ist so ähnlich wie: kompass --sass-dir media / sass - -css-dID-Medien / CSS -Output-Stil Compact -Watchconfiguration Referenzierte JAGO-EinstellungSthese sollte in Ihre Settings.py-Datei gehen. Kompass sollte CSS.note ausgeben, dass keiner von diesen nachlaufenden Schrägstrichen haben sollte. Sie können absolute oder relative Pfade sein; Wenn relativ, werden sie mit dem aktuellen Arbeitsverzeichnis aufgelöst. Standardeinstellungen "Kompass" - compass_style: einer der "verschachtelten", "expandiert", "kompakt" oder "komprimiert", wobei der Stil der erzeugten CSS-Ausgabe angibt. Der Standardwert ist "kompakt" .- compass_requires: Eine Reihenfolge von Ruby-Bibliotheken, die erforderlich sind, bevor Kompass-Befehle ausgeführt werden. Wird für die Asset-URL-Helfer des Kompasses verwendet) .- compass_relative_urls: boolean angeben, ob die Asset-URL-Helfer von Compass relative URLs.command-line-optionsthese-Optionen erstellen soll, können zur Laufzeit weitergegeben werden, um zu beeinflussen, wie der Kompass ausgeführt wird.--t, Drucken Sie ein vollständiges Stacktrace auf Compass Fehlern.product's Homepage


django-compass2. Zugehörige Software